Structural Composition
Ac-Glu-Glu-Met-Gln-Arg-Arg-Ala-Asp-NH₂
Physical Properties
SNAP-8 (Acetyl Octapeptide-3) is a synthetic octapeptide derived from a fragment of the SNAP-25 protein. N-terminal acetylation and C-terminal amidation enhance structural stability under research conditions. Its short chain length supports strong aqueous solubility and efficient laboratory handling. As with other small linear peptides, protection from moisture, light exposure, and repeated freeze–thaw cycles helps preserve structural integrity and maintain analytical consistency during laboratory applications.

Identity
Each production lot is checked against the reference structure recorded for this compound:
- Classification — Synthetic octapeptide (acetylated SNAP-25 fragment analog)
- Molecular formula — C₄₁H₇₀N₁₆O₁₆S
- Expected mass — ~1,075.2 Da
- CAS registry — 868844-74-0
- Chain length — 8 amino acids (N-acetylated, C-terminal amidated)
- PubChem CID — Not available
Analytical Methods
Testing is carried out per lot by an independent laboratory. The methods measure what the material is and how much of it is the target compound:
- RP-HPLC — reverse-phase separation of the target from process-related impurities; purity is reported as area percent of the main peak
- Mass spectrometry — observed mass compared against the expected molecular mass above
- Retention time — compared against a reference standard run under the same conditions
- Chromatogram — reproduced on the certificate so the peak and any shoulders can be inspected directly

Laboratory Handling and Storage Protocols
Lyophilized Powder Storage
- Store at –20°C to –80°C in the original, sealed vial
- Protect from light exposure and moisture
- A desiccated storage environment is recommended
- Stability data suggests extended stability when stored at −20 °C or below.
Reconstituted Solution Storage
- Short-term storage: Up to 7 days at 4°C
- Long-term storage: Store at –20°C in aliquots
- Use single-use aliquots to preserve peptide integrity
- Minimize freeze–thaw cycles; single-use aliquots are strongly recommended

Frequently Asked Questions
What is SNAP-8?
SNAP-8 is a synthetic eight–amino acid peptide fragment modeled after a portion of the SNAP-25 protein. It is used in research to investigate vesicle fusion mechanisms and synaptic signaling pathways.
Is SNAP-8 a naturally occurring peptide?
No. SNAP-8 is a synthetically engineered fragment derived from a naturally occurring protein (SNAP-25), but it does not occur naturally in this isolated peptide form.
How does SNAP-8 differ from SNAP-25?
SNAP-25 is a full-length neuronal protein involved in vesicle fusion, whereas SNAP-8 is a short synthetic fragment designed to model and study specific regions of the protein in experimental systems.
